Icahn Enhances Influence with Caesars Board Appointments
Portfolio - People | Mar 22, 2025 | EIN

Carl Icahn, a renowned activist investor, continues to exert significant influence over Caesars Entertainment following his successful maneuverings in the company's board and merger with Eldorado. Recently, Icahn appointed Jesse Lynn and Ted Papapostolou from Icahn Enterprises to Caesars' expanded board. Icahn suggests a separation of Caesars Digital, a rapidly growing sector in Caesars' portfolio, might unlock significant shareholder value. With digital gaming peers traded at higher multiples and Caesars Digital accounting for only 3% of Caesars' total EBITDA, a spinoff could adjust the market valuation significantly. Icahn's storied history in transforming casino businesses and his confidence in Caesars' management team indicate potential for cooperative strategies ahead, amidst an evolving gaming industry landscape.

Financials
- $4.6 billion to $7.6 billion – Estimated standalone value of Caesars Digital based on projected 2025 EBITDA and a multiple range of 15 to 25 times.
- $305 million – 2025E adjusted EBITDA for Caesars Digital.
- 8.43-times EBITDA – Current trading multiple for Caesars Entertainment as a whole.
- $11.2 billion – Current annual revenue for Caesars Entertainment.
- $2.3 billion – Current operating income for Caesars Entertainment.
